one thing that could be affecting the meter reading is how you are filling your tank. if you don't fill up the same way or use the same pump every time, you can get variance.

I always fill it up to the first click. even this has some variance in it as sometimes the gas foams more than others.

I would say you could average out 3 tanks and what the ecometer does over those 3 tanks and do a comparison with that.

I will say that the difference is about a half gallon so I wouldn't think that the variance I am talking about would have been that much but it is still a factor to consider.
